To be able to use counters/sets/maps in Riak I have to store the object
into a defined bucket_type indexed via SOLR.
However, this will require extra disk space as data will be indexed (if
using the default schema). Can I create a custom schema "ignoring" all
fields so nothing is indexed? I don't need to use Riak Search on these
objects, as I always know the KEY to fetch them. A schema like this would
work? ( I guess that I can not put [ indexed="false" ] in the "_yz*" fields
required by Riak, right? Or is it possible to not index that data either? )
—+—+—+—+—+—+—+—+—+—+—+—+—+—+—+—+—+—+—+—+—+—+—+—+—+—
<?xml version="1.0" encoding="UTF-8" ?>
<schema name="schedule" version="1.5">
<fields>
<dynamicField name="*" type="ignored" />
<!-- All of these fields are required by Riak Search -->
<field name="_yz_id" type="_yz_str" indexed="true" stored="true"
multiValued="false" required="true"/>
<field name="_yz_ed" type="_yz_str" indexed="true" stored="false"
multiValued="false"/>
<field name="_yz_pn" type="_yz_str" indexed="true" stored="false"
multiValued="false"/>
<field name="_yz_fpn" type="_yz_str" indexed="true" stored="false"
multiValued="false"/>
<field name="_yz_vtag" type="_yz_str" indexed="true" stored="false"
multiValued="false"/>
<field name="_yz_rk" type="_yz_str" indexed="true" stored="true"
multiValued="false"/>
<field name="_yz_rt" type="_yz_str" indexed="true" stored="true"
multiValued="false"/>
<field name="_yz_rb" type="_yz_str" indexed="true" stored="true"
multiValued="false"/>
<field name="_yz_err" type="_yz_str" indexed="true" stored="false"
multiValued="false"/>
</fields>
<uniqueKey>_yz_id</uniqueKey>
<types>
<fieldtype name="ignored" stored="false" indexed="false"
multiValued="true" class="solr.StrField" />
<!-- YZ String: Used for non-analyzed fields -->
<fieldType name="_yz_str" class="solr.StrField" sortMissingLast="true"
/>
</types>
</schema>
—+—+—+—+—+—+—+—+—+—+—+—+—+—+—+—+—+—+—+—+—+—+—+—+—+—
Another question, can I use the [ compressed="true" ] to save disk space?
in both <dynamicField name="*" type="ignored" /> and "_yz*" fields?
